Essential Aspects of Kitchen Cabinets Shelves Ideas

Kitchen cabinets are a vital component of any kitchen design. They provide essential storage space for cookware, utensils, food items, and more. To maximize the functionality and aesthetics of your kitchen, it's crucial to carefully consider the shelves within your cabinets. Here are some key aspects to keep in mind when designing your kitchen cabinet shelves:

Height and Spacing

The height and spacing between shelves determine the efficiency and accessibility of your storage space. For frequently used items, opt for shorter shelves placed closer together to allow easy reach. Taller shelves can accommodate larger items that are used less often. Adjustable shelves provide flexibility to accommodate items of different heights.

Depth

The depth of your cabinet shelves significantly impacts storage capacity. Standard depths range from 12 to 24 inches. Deeper shelves can hold more items, but may require shelves with dividers or pull-outs for better organization. For narrower cabinets, shallow shelves may be more practical to avoid wasted space.

Materials

The material of your cabinet shelves plays a role in their durability, functionality, and aesthetics. Common materials include:

  • Wood: Natural and durable, but may require sealing or finishing to prevent damage from moisture.
  • Laminate: Affordable and easy to clean, but may not be as strong as wood.
  • Wire: Provides good air circulation and visibility, but may not be suitable for heavy items.
  • Glass: Adds a touch of elegance and allows for easy viewing, but can be more fragile.

Accessories

Various accessories can enhance the functionality of your cabinet shelves. Consider the following options:

  • Shelf dividers: Create additional compartments on shelves, allowing for more organized storage.
  • Pull-outs: Glide out for easy access to items stored deep within cabinets.
  • Lazy Susans: Rotating shelves maximize storage space in corner cabinets.
  • Knife blocks: Safely store knives while keeping them organized and within reach.

Design Considerations

When designing your kitchen cabinet shelves, keep these aesthetic considerations in mind:

  • Color: The color of your shelves can complement or contrast the cabinetry, creating a cohesive look.
  • Texture: Mixing materials with different textures adds visual interest to your cabinets.
  • Lighting: Under-cabinet lighting illuminates shelves, making it easier to find items.
  • Door style: The style of your cabinet doors can impact the overall look of your shelves.

Maximizing Storage

To maximize the storage capacity of your kitchen cabinets, follow these tips:

  • Use vertical space: Stack items vertically using stackable containers or shelves.
  • Store similar items together: Group like items to make them easier to find.
  • Declutter regularly: Remove unused items and donate or discard items that are no longer needed.
  • Consider custom shelves: Custom shelves can be designed to fit specific storage needs and maximize available space.
